Our verdict is Likely benign. Variant got -4 ACMG points: 0P and 4B. BS2
The NM_004350.3(RUNX3):c.860C>T(p.Thr287Met) variant causes a missense change. The variant allele was found at a frequency of 0.0000232 in 1,597,946 control chromosomes in the GnomAD database, with no homozygous occurrence. Variant has been reported in ClinVar as Uncertain significance (★).

The c.902C>T (p.T301M) alteration is located in exon 6 (coding exon 6) of the RUNX3 gene. This alteration results from a C to T substitution at nucleotide position 902, causing the threonine (T) at amino acid position 301 to be replaced by a methionine (M). Based on insufficient or conflicting evidence, the clinical significance of this alteration remains unclear. -
